Kimberly is no stranger to our office: we first met her in 2017, when she worked at Wille Donker as a student intern. At that time still in Alphen aan den Rijn. After a period in notarial practice in The Hague and her work as a family and inheritance lawyer in Amsterdam, our paths now cross again in Bodegraven.

Her interest in probate law arose during her time in the notary’s office. Drafting wills and prenuptial agreements, combined with settling estates, led to a love of the profession that has remained ever since. “By now, I wouldn’t want it any other way either,” Kimberly says.

Thanks to her experience in both notarial and legal practice, Kimberly knows that settling an estate is more than just a legal process. It is often an emotional process in which strategic thinking and empathetic action come together. “Settling an estate is not just about inheritance law, but also about loss and coping,” she explains. “I want my clients to know that they are not alone. Together, we work to find the best solution – one that is not only practical, but also helps them find peace and closure.”
